Comprehending the IELTS Test Format
Before diving into the schedule, it is essential to comprehend the IELTS test format, which consists of four main parts:
Listening-- 30 minutesReading-- 60 minutesWriting-- 60 minutesSpeaking-- 11 to 14 minutes
There are two variations of the IELTS: Academic and General Training. The Academic version is customized for those looking for college, while the General Training variation is meant for those aiming for work experience or migration.
